Overview of Poker Betting:

Poker gambling refers to the work of placing wagers during different phases of a hand. It is usually initiated by the player left associated with the supplier, as well as the betting continues clockwise across the table. The primary intent behind betting in poker is to win the cooking pot, containing all the potato chips or cash wagered because of the players. The scale and time of wagers are very important in influencing opponents' choices and eventually determining the results of a hand.

Techniques for Poker Betting:

1. Hand Analysis: Before placing a bet, you should evaluate the effectiveness of your hand. Evaluate aspects like the quality of your cards, their possible to boost, and their particular relative energy compared to the neighborhood cards (in texas holdem). Adjust your gambling appropriately, placing larger wagers with stronger fingers and smaller wagers with marginal holdings.

2. Position: consider carefully your seating place within dining table whenever deciding how much to bet. Being in a belated place lets you gather additional information regarding your opponents' wagering habits, enabling you to make more informed decisions. Aggressive gambling and bluffing in many cases are more efficient in belated jobs, as opponents have already expressed their views from the power of these hands.

3. Bet Sizing: Properly sizing your bets is a must. Prevent making foreseeable bets or constantly wagering similar quantity, as observant opponents can take advantage of this. Differ your wager dimensions on the basis of the strength of the hand, modifying it to reach a balance between extracting worth and avoiding losses. Also, think about the cooking pot chances additionally the potential of one's hand to boost when deciding on wager size.

Guidelines and greatest Methods:

1. Reading Opponents: absorb the wagering patterns, body gestures, and spoken cues of the opponents. These could provide important ideas in their holdings which help you make much better choices. Search for any deviations from their particular standard behavior, that might indicate weakness or strength.

2. Bluffing: Bluffing is an essential element of poker wagering. The target should make opponents think that you have a stronger hand than you actually do. Bluff selectively and start thinking about aspects like the board surface, your dining table image, as well as your opponents' inclinations. Bear in mind, successful bluffing calls for good knowledge of your opponents' playing designs.

3. Bankroll control: Effective money administration is essential to sustaining long-term success in poker. Determine a budget for the poker sessions and give a wide berth to putting bets away from means. Develop discipline and prevent chasing losses or making impulsive big wagers might compromise your bankroll.
